Ned Thompson Labs performs tests on super alloys, titanium, aluminum, and most metals. Tests on metal composites that rely upon scanning electron microscope results can be subcontracted, or the labs can purchase new equipment. Evaluate the sensitivity of the economic decision to purchase the equipment over a range of 20% ± (in 10% increments) of the estimates for P, AOC, R , n , and MARR (range on MARR is 12% to 16%). Use the AW method and plot the results on a sensitivity graph (like Figure). For which parameter(s) is the AW most sensitive? Least sensitive?
Sensitivity analysis graph of percent variation from the most likely estimate

Ned Thompson Labs performs tests on super alloys, titanium, alum

First cost P = $ˆ’220,000
Salvage S = $20,000
Life n = 10 years
Annual operating cost AOC = $ˆ’30,000/year
Annual revenue R = $70,000 per year
MARR i = 15% peryear
